Wham! Days and Breakthrough Hits

Wham! Days marked the start of George Michael's iconic career. With infectious pop tunes and lively performances, the duo captured the hearts of millions. Hits like "Wake Me Up Before You Go-Go" and "Club Tropicana" showcased their high-energy and catchy melodies, making them favorites on the charts. Their breakthrough in the music industry laid the foundation for George Michael's solo success.

Wham! became synonymous with youthful exuberance and a fresh sound that resonated with a generation seeking escapism through music. Their influence can still be felt today in the pop landscape, inspiring countless artists to create music that uplifts and brings joy to listeners.

George Michael as a Solo Artist

  • After the break-up of Wham!, George Michael embarked on a successful solo career that cemented his status as a Last Christmas icon.
  • He released his debut solo album "Faith" in 1987, showcasing his musical versatility and songwriting prowess.
  • George Michael's solo hits like "Careless Whisper" and "Father Figure" demonstrated his soulful vocals and ability to connect with his audience.
  • His openness about his personal life, including his sexuality, challenged societal norms and inspired many.
  • George Michael's solo success solidified his position as a talented artist beyond his Wham! days, leaving a lasting impact on the music industry.

Writing and Recording of 'Last Christmas'

The iconic holiday song "Last Christmas" was written and recorded by George Michael in 1984. Michael drew inspiration from his personal experiences and heartbreak, which gave the track its emotional depth. The song features catchy melodies and memorable lyrics that resonate with listeners even after decades. Michael's skillful songwriting and storytelling abilities shine through in this timeless classic.

The recording process involved meticulous attention to detail, ensuring every instrument and vocal harmonization blended seamlessly. The result was a beautifully crafted composition that captures the essence of Christmas and love lost. "Last Christmas" remains a testament to George Michael's artistic talent and continues to bring joy to listeners worldwide.
